Middle and High School students all over the country will be wearing new school uniforms at the start of this upcoming spring semester. These new uniforms will be inspired by the traditional dress of Korea: Hanbok.
Team Effort
This whole thing started back in 2019. The KCDF (Korea Craft and Design Foundation) announced that it would hold two competitions. One would be a competition for designers to create Hanbok-inspired school uniforms.
The other would be for schools. 25 Korean middle and high schools would be chosen to start an โuniform transitionโ. The schools would have to demonstrate their desire to bring unique traditional aspects of Korean culture into the modern era. After the selection, these schools would be able to receive financial support in exchange for promoting the use of traditionally inspired uniforms.
The KDF then got the backing of the Korean Ministry of Culture, Sports and Tourism. These organizations expanded the projectโs budget and helped to increase marketing. The main goal of all of these organizations is to promote the preservation of Korean culture through hanbok uniforms.
Hanbok Inspired Fashion Gallery
Last year, the final designs were part of an exhibition at the KCDF Gallery in Insadong, Seoul. People from all over Korea could go and see the beautiful designs on display in a fashion gallery.
The uniforms are not only pretty but also functional. They have fresh and modern looking designs, made using comfortable materials. However, the designs preserve the key parts of the hanbok such as the front ribbon and the cross neck. There were a total of 81 different uniform designs that were selected from last yearโs completion last year.
The Future of Hanbok Inspired Uniforms
19 schools across the country have already begun adopting Hanbok inspired uniforms and 34 more are expected to adopt them within the 2022 school year. We will undoubtedly see more and more schools adopt the trend over the next several years.
Additionally, the KCDF is developing projects to promote hanbok in the service and hospitality industries. In places such as hotels, high-end restaurants, and the airport hanbok inspired uniforms will likely become commonplace.
